    IN CONTRACT. The Majestic So majestic, classic art deco, spacious, and ready to make it your own. As soon as one enters the Majestic on the corner of 72nd St and CPW, it is most obvious that you are in one of the finest white glove buildings in New York City. The lobby sets the tone for elegance and luxury with the door staff, gorgeous original art deco details including terrazzo floors, decorative wood panels, ceiling moldings and classic furnishings. When you enter into this majestic almost 1700 sq ft apartment, you immediately notice the famous Dakota residence directly north across the street. Other views include south facing over the townhouses of the UWS, as well as to the 72nd Street entrance to Central Park and Strawberry Fields. Inside, there is a most spacious entry foyer welcoming you to the rest of the sprawling residence. The living room is oversized and has a gorgeous original stone decorative fireplace. The original parquet wood floors, decorative art deco crown 9.5' high ceilings, and deco moldings throughout confirm you are in a luxury space. Throughout the home, there are 6 oversized/extra deep closets. Washer/dryer allowed to be installed. The large kitchen has tons of cabinets and workspace. One can eat at the counter bar or choose to dine in the spacious "L" dining area off the kitchen and living room. If desired, the dining area can easily be converted for a multitude of other residential uses. The bedroom wing is off the foyer and separately quiet from the living spaces. The primary bedroom is oversized with south facing views getting lovely sunlight all day. There is an en-suite bathroom with original art deco finishes and fixtures along with a dressing area/home office space. Serene at its best. The second bedroom is oversized with great views of the Dakota. There is a full bathroom in the hallway adjacent to this bedroom or convenient as a guest bathroom. Fitness center will soon be updated abd enlarged, bicycle storage upon avialability. Special Assessment from July 2022- December 2023- $536.71 Majestic in every way. Showings by appointment only.
